A rectangular field is four times as long as it is wideIf the perimeter of the field is 300yards, what are the field's dimensions?
Answer:
Length = 120 yards, width = 30 yards.
Step-by-step explanation:
Lets use \(l\) for length and \(w\) for width.
The perimeter of a rectangular field is \(2l + 2w\). We can construct the following equations:
\(4w = l\).
\(2l + 2w = 300.\)
If we plug \(4w\) in for \(l\) into the second equation, we get:
\(2w + 2(4w) = 300.\)
\(2w+8w = 300.\)
\(10w = 300.\)
\(w= 30.\)
Plug 30 in for \(w\) into the first equation.
\(l = 4*30 = 120.\)
Length = 120 yards, width = 30 yards.

Find a solution to the linear equation −2x−2y=−12.
hw to solve 6x-12/3+4=18/x
The two solutions of the equation:
(6x - 12)/3 + 4 = 18/x
Are x = 3 and x = -3
How to solve the equation?Here we have the following equation:
(6x - 12)/3 + 4 = 18/x
Notice that in the right side we have x on a denominator, then x can not be zero, so x ≠ 0.
Now, let's start by simplifying the left side:
(6x - 12)/3+ 4 = 18/x
2x - 4 + 4 = 18/x
2x = 18/x
Now we can multiply both sides by x so we get:
2x^2 = 18
Now divide both sides by 2:
x^2 = 18/2
x^2 = 9
Finally, apply the square root in both sides:
√x^2 = ±√9
x = ±3
The two solutions are x = 3 and x = -3

Black & Decker Manufacturing sold a set of saws to True Value Hardware. The list price was $3,800. Black & Decker offered a chain discount of 8/3/1. The net price of the saws is:
The net price of the saws that Black & Decker Manufacturing sold to True Value Hardware on a chain discount of 8/3/1 is $3,357.21.
What is a chain discount?A chain discount refers to a type of discount offered to customers, which is sequentially applied to the list price to arrive at the net price.
Chain discounts involve a series of trade discounts applied in sequence.
Data and Calculations:List price = $3,800
Chain discount = 8/3/1
First net price = $3,496 ($3,800 x 1 - 8%)
Second net price = $3,391.12 ($3,496 x 1 - 3%)
Third net price = $3,357.21 ($3,391.12 x 1 - 1%)
Thus, the net price based on a chain discount of 8/3/1 is $3,357.21.

A scientist wants a 64 milliliter acid solution with a concentration of 8%. She has concentrations of 2% and 10%. How much
of each solution must she use to get the desired concentration?
Answer:
16 milliliters of 2% solution
48 milliliters of 10% solution
Step-by-step explanation:
x = 2% solution
y = 10% solution
System of Equations:
x + y = 64
.02x + .10y = 64(.08)
use Substitution: y = 64 - x
.02x + .10(64 - x) = 5.12
.02x + 6.4 - .10x = 5.12
-.08x = -1.28
x = 16
y = 64 - 16 which equals 48

Kelly manages an apartment complex with 60 apartments. The monthly rent for an
apartment in the complex is $803, of which Kelly gets 9.5%. How much does Kelly
earn in a year?
State your answer in terms of dollars rounded to the nearest whole dollar.
Answer:
$54925
Step-by-step explanation:
Monthly Rent = 803
Number of apartments = 60
Kelly's commission = 9.5% -> 9.5/100 = 0.095
So
803*60*0.095 = ?
4577.10 per month.
12 months in a year
4577.10 * 12 = $54925.20
Rounded to nearest whole dollar 54925
Kelly makes $54925 per year
